AWS GovCloud ITAR Platform

Regulated access. In-boundary identity. Recoverable operations.A sanitized two-region AWS GovCloud platform reference spanning ITAR-aligned Citrix VDI, hybrid identity, application migration, in-boundary SIEM, FIPS cryptography, private administration, and pilot-light disaster recovery.
